Children Spinning Tops in Brodowski Square

Candido Portinari1933

Composition in black and white. Contour lines. It depicts children playing in the square of spinning top Brodowski. In the center of the composition, circle drawn on the floor with four tops and four boys in his back. At the bottom on the left, the greater boy, crouched profile to the right, spinning top with the on the right hand. In the background on the horizon, houses with fences and on the right, slightly ahead, the Church of Saint Anthony.

Details

  • Title: Children Spinning Tops in Brodowski Square
  • Creator Lifespan: 1903-12-29 - 1962-12-06
  • Creator Nationality: Brazilian
  • Creator Gender: Male
  • Creator Death Place: Rio de Janeiro, Rio de Janeiro, Brazil
  • Creator Birth Place: Brodowski, São Paulo, Brazil
  • Date: 1933
  • Location Created: Brodowski, São Paulo, Brasil
  • Physical Dimensions: w35 x h21cm without frame
  • Provenance: João Candido Portinari
  • Rights: João Candido Portinari
  • External Link: Projeto Portinari
  • Theme: Brazilian Culture:children's games:play:tops, Nature:landscape:Brodowski, human figure:group:children
  • Technique: lead pencil
  • Signature: Unsigned and undated
  • Painter: Candido Portinari
  • Number: FCO 539
  • Inscription: On reverse, rough sketch of figures possibly by the artist; authentication and inscriptions by Maria Portinari "DN 175” and "Nº 431”.
  • Function: Study for the drawing “Game of Tops” [FCO 3004]
  • Catalogue Raisonné: CR-343
